One of the largest campuses in India, LPU provides ample living arrangements for both staff and students. Each room comes equipped with an attached bathroom, a bed (without a mattress), a table, a chair, and almirahs. Power is provided through 24-hour hotlines; every room has a geyser that delivers hot water during the winter (at designated times) for two hours per room; there is an on-campus hospital with an ambulance available to offer medical assistance to students; Wi-Fi is accessible for internet connectivity via a system. Vegetarian and non-vegetarian [on request] meals are offered at the mess facility. On campus, separate living accommodations exist for boys and girls. There is a zero-tolerance policy regarding disciplinary measures, drug use, alcohol, smoking, or ragging Misconduct: On university grounds, these are strictly prohibited. Safety and security: With CCTV installed in crucial areas throughout the campus and round-the-clock, 365-day security available, residential facilities on campus are considerably safer and more secure. Competent security personnel are responsible for safety. Turnstile Gates: Access to residential buildings is controlled by automated turnstiles (similar to those in metro trains) and biometric devices, with information recorded in a computerized database to track the locations of students and guests. Sanitary Mess Plan: The residential facility's multi-cuisine menu is offered four times daily, and the mess is of high quality, clean, and nutritious. The primary contributor to an excellent mess strategy in residential accommodations is consistent vendor oversight. Each residential unit is equipped with an automatic chapatti-making machine, which is time-efficient and hygienic. Furthermore, students have the option to occasionally have their mess or, for those who choose not to, dine in the cafeteria located in residential buildings and at other important areas on campus. Medical Facility: The university provides 24-hour medical and ambulance services, in addition to 30 hospital beds on campus. The hospital employs medical lab technicians, nurses, dieticians, physiotherapists, psychologists, specialists, resident medical officers, and physician assistants.
